Information for parents regarding school trips

At times throughout the year classes will book educational trips to support the curriculum in school. Trips are agreed by the head teacher and fully risk-assessed to ensure the trip is safe and appropriate.

Below is listed some important information about school trips:

1) School uniform must be worn unless otherwise instructed by the class teacher.

3) School trips will return back to school for usual transport home, unless you have been informed otherwise.

4) Please ensure pupils are prepared for all weathers at whatever time of year.  E.g. Waterproof coat, suitable footwear and a hat/sun cream (in the summer term).

5) If your child receives free school meals then a school packed-lunch will be provided.

6) You may be asked to provide a voluntary contribution to cover the cost of the trip.

7) If you have any questions regarding school trips, more information can be gained from class staff around the time of the trip.

8) If you have any information about your child that is important for us to be aware of when out in the community then please let a member of class staff know.
